The arrival of actresses like Priyanka Chopra , Kareena Kapoor Khan , and Deepika Padukone ushered in flawed, relatable romantic leads. In Jab We Met (2007), Kareena’s Geet is impulsive, loud, and breaks her own heart before finding “the one.” Deepika’s Veronica in Cocktail (2012) offered a gritty storyline: the “wild” friend who doesn’t get the guy, subverting the traditional happy ending. These narratives mirrored a new India where love was no longer simple.
